Which value emphasizes the importance of skills and knowledge in DECA?

The emphasis on skills and knowledge in DECA aligns perfectly with the value of competence. Competence refers to the ability to effectively perform tasks and apply learned knowledge in real-world situations, which is essential for success in business and marketing environments. This value highlights the necessity for individuals to not only possess information but also to be able to utilize it skillfully to achieve desired outcomes. In the context of DECA, which fosters professional development through competitive events, workshops, and networking opportunities, competence ensures that members are well-prepared and capable of demonstrating their abilities effectively. This foundational skill set is critical for achieving career readiness and advancing in the business world.

Integrity, innovation, and teamwork, while also important values in DECA and business in general, do not directly address the specific focus on skills and knowledge. Integrity pertains to honesty and ethical behavior, innovation relates to creativity and new ideas, and teamwork emphasizes collaboration and working with others, all valuable but distinct concepts that complement rather than define the central focus on competence.
